Abstract

Disclosed are methods of inducing maturation of antigen presenting cells and cytotoxic T lymphocyte responses utilizing agonist anti-CD40 antibodies that do not block the binding of CD40L to CD40.

Claims (6)

1. A method for enhancing a human antigen presenting cell (APC)-mediated human cytotoxic T lymphocyte (CTL) response, comprising stimulating an APC with an agonist anti-CD40 antibody, or a chimeric antibody, humanized antibody, single chain antibody or CD40 binding fragment thereof, which is capable of blocking binding of CD40L on a human T lymphocyte to CD40 on a human APC by 16–88%, wherein said anti-CD40 antibody is produced by a hybridoma with American Type Culture Collection (ATCC) deposit designation PTA-2993, PTA-2994, PTA-2995, PTA-2996, PTA-2997, PTA-2998, or PTA-2999.

2. A method for enhancing an antigen-specific cytotoxic T cell lymphocyte (CTL) response, wherein said CTL is activated with a human antigen presenting cell (APC) and wherein said APC is stimulated via the CD40 receptor with an anti-CD40 antibody, or a chimeric antibody, humanized antibody, single chain antibody or CD40 binding fragment thereof, which binds to said receptor and blocks binding of CD40L to CD40 by 16–88%, and further wherein said anti-CD40 antibody is produced by a hybridoma with American Type Culture Collection (ATCC) deposit designation PTA-2993, PTA-2994, PTA-2995, PTA-2996, PTA-2997, PTA-2998, or PTA-2999.

3. A method for enhancing an antigen specific cytotoxic T lymphocyte (CTL) response according to claim 2 , wherein said antibody, or said chimeric antibody, humanized antibody, single chain antibody or CD40 binding fragment thereof, blocks binding of CD40 L to CD40 by 16–25%.

4. The method of claim 2 , wherein the antigen presenting cell is a monocyte derived dendritic cell.

5. The method of claim 2 , further comprising administering IFN-γ.

6. The method of claim 2 , wherein the agonist anti-CD40 antibody, or said chimeric antibody, humanized antibody, single chain antibody or CD40 binding fragment thereof, is administered by injection.
